Riddles are little poems or phrases that pose a question that needs answering. Riddles frequently rhyme, but this is not a requirement.A two hundred dollar purchase
With a twenty-five dollar rent,
Until you have all four of us,
Then an even return you'll get.
One is next to Illinois,
And one borders Virginia.
One has no state name next to it,
The fourth's near Pennsylvania
What are we?
